New Trek film go?

Writer assigned to pen a further Star Trek film.

With the end of Enterprise and the suspension of any further development of Trek on the TV, you could be forgiven for thinking that a further film would be not be high on Paramount's slate.

Apparently you'd be wrong, for the company has announced that Erik Jendresen is working on a draft for the eleventh film in the franchise.

Jenderson's previous work includes Band of Brothers.

There is no news as to which crew the film would focus on, but with Enterprise axed it would seem unlikely that the movie will also be a prequel story, as rumoured.
